RC3225F3242CS Equivalent & Substitute Parts

Part Overview

The RC3225F3242CS is a 32.4 kOhms ±1% 1/3W chip resistor manufactured by Samsung Electro-Mechanics in the 1210 (3225 Metric) package. This thick film, moisture-resistant component operates across -55°C to 155°C and is ROHS3 compliant with MSL 1 rating. The part is currently in active production status with 973 units in stock.

Substitute parts are necessary when the primary component becomes unavailable, when design requirements shift toward higher power ratings or automotive-grade specifications, or when supply chain optimization requires alternative sourcing from qualified manufacturers.

Substitute Part Grouping Explanation

Substitution eligibility for the RC3225F3242CS is determined by strict adherence to the following parameters:

Critical Matching Requirements:

  • Resistance value must be exactly 32.4 kOhms
  • Tolerance must be ±1% or tighter
  • Package must be 1210 (3225 Metric) for PCB footprint compatibility
  • Number of terminations must be 2
  • Power rating must be equal to or greater than 0.333W

Important Compatibility Requirements:

  • Composition must be thick film
  • Temperature coefficient must be ±100ppm/°C or better
  • Operating temperature range must encompass -55°C to 155°C
  • RoHS3 compliance required
  • MSL rating must be 1 or equivalent

Acceptable Variations:

  • Power rating may exceed 0.333W (higher ratings are acceptable)
  • Physical dimensions may vary slightly within 1210 package specification
  • Product status may differ (active or not for new designs)
  • Packaging format may differ (bulk, tape & reel, etc.)
  • Automotive certifications (AEC-Q200) are acceptable enhancements

Engineering Selection Recommendations

Primary Part Selection (RC3225F3242CS): Select the RC3225F3242CS when active production status and standard industrial applications are required. This component is currently in active production with substantial inventory availability (973 units in stock). Use this part for new designs requiring standard thick film resistor performance without automotive-grade specifications.

Substitute Part Selection (ERJ-14NF3242U): The ERJ-14NF3242U from Panasonic Electronic Components qualifies as a direct substitute based on matching resistance, tolerance, package, composition, temperature coefficient, and operating temperature range. This substitute provides a higher power rating (0.5W versus 0.333W), which offers additional thermal margin in the application. The ERJ-14NF3242U carries AEC-Q200 automotive qualification, making it suitable for automotive and high-reliability applications. However, this part is marked "Not For New Designs," indicating it may have limited future availability. Select this substitute when higher power dissipation capability is beneficial or when automotive-grade components are specified.

Compliance Verification: Both parts maintain ROHS3 compliance and MSL 1 rating, ensuring regulatory adherence and simplified handling procedures. Both components are suitable for the full -55°C to 155°C operating temperature range.

Frequently Asked Questions (FAQ)

Q: Can the ERJ-14NF3242U replace the RC3225F3242CS in existing designs?

A: Yes. The ERJ-14NF3242U meets all critical electrical parameters (32.4 kOhms ±1%, ±100ppm/°C temperature coefficient, -55°C to 155°C operating range) and uses the identical 1210 (3225 Metric) package. The higher power rating (0.5W versus 0.333W) is acceptable and provides additional thermal margin. Both components are ROHS3 compliant with MSL 1 rating.

Q: What is the significance of the "Not For New Designs" status on the ERJ-14NF3242U?

A: This designation indicates that Panasonic has discontinued active development and promotion of this part number for new applications. While the component remains functionally equivalent and available in inventory (11,568 units), it may have limited long-term availability. For new designs, the RC3225F3242CS is the preferred choice due to its active production status.

Q: Are there physical dimension differences between these parts?

A: Both components use the 1210 (3225 Metric) package with nearly identical dimensions. The RC3225F3242CS measures 0.126" L x 0.100" W (3.20mm x 2.55mm) with 0.026" maximum seated height. The ERJ-14NF3242U measures 0.126" L x 0.098" W (3.20mm x 2.50mm) with 0.028" maximum seated height. These minor variations fall within standard 1210 package tolerances and do not affect PCB footprint compatibility.

Q: What does AEC-Q200 certification on the ERJ-14NF3242U indicate?

A: AEC-Q200 is an automotive industry qualification standard for passive components. This certification confirms the ERJ-14NF3242U meets stringent automotive reliability, temperature cycling, and performance requirements. The RC3225F3242CS does not carry this certification, making the ERJ-14NF3242U the appropriate choice for automotive applications.

Q: Can I use a lower power rating substitute if my circuit only requires 0.2W?

A: No. Substitutes must meet or exceed the power rating of the original component (0.333W minimum). Using a lower-rated component creates thermal stress and reliability risk. The RC3225F3242CS and ERJ-14NF3242U both meet this requirement.

Q: Are tolerance and temperature coefficient interchangeable between these parts?

A: No. Both the RC3225F3242CS and ERJ-14NF3242U share identical tolerance (±1%) and temperature coefficient (±100ppm/°C) specifications. These parameters must match exactly for direct substitution. Deviations in either parameter would affect circuit accuracy and stability.

Q: What is the difference between bulk and tape & Reel packaging?

A: The RC3225F3242CS is supplied in bulk packaging, while the ERJ-14NF3242U is supplied in Tape & Reel (TR) format. Tape & Reel packaging is optimized for automated assembly processes, while bulk packaging is suitable for manual assembly or smaller production runs. The electrical and mechanical properties of the components are identical regardless of packaging format.
